Bringing characters to life on stage is a demanding but exciting career path. To reach the stage, in addition to a great deal of natural talent, there’s also a lot of technical training involved, and that’s where our theatre arts programs come in. Our students train at the Young Centre for the Performing Arts, and are exposed to professional directors, stage managers, designers, and technicians. And in the final year of their studies, students get to experience what it’s like to perform a season.

The Young Centre for the Performing Arts was envisioned by George Brown College and Soulpepper Theatre Company to be a home to Toronto’s arts community and a destination for all theatre lovers. Anchored by the presence of Soulpepper’s year-round repertory season and George Brown College’s Theatre School, the Young Centre provides a home for both the leading artists of today, as well as the arts leaders of tomorrow.
